WebThe law requires—in most situations—that the police get a warrant in order to gather historical cellphone location information kept by cellphone and wireless network providers. The U.S. Supreme Court established this privacy rule for all the country in the 2024 case Carpenter v. United States. (138 S. Ct. 2206.)
